Transaction deddd36a9f29593fb172fd3640d70d64617a92d7f2845e2965514a79b6ab6638
1 Input
1 Output
-
deddd36a9f29593fb172fd3640d70d64617a92d7f2845e2965514a79b6ab6638:0
- value
- 76843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1283d0bcaa24b3e71631bde9ae34c91545b484af OP_EQUAL
- address
- 33NuzgxgXPS5SsBpxcgTqqmRbcJYcXeoUj